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ly St. Cloud Apartments

What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in St. Cloud?

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in St. Cloud is at The Cloud on Fifth listed at $550.

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ly St. Cloud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in St. Cloud is $1,156.

What is the largest Pet Friendly St. Cloud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in St. Cloud is a 1,750 square feet unit starting from $1,330 at Regency Park.

What is the average size for St. Cloud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in St. Cloud is currently at 684 sq ft.
